Description
1. 2006 TL 74 NE 18/61 19.12.61
CLARE
CLARE High Street (West Side) No 1 (Post Office & house)
II GV
2. Together with No 41 Nethergate Street, a late C15 or early C16 timber framed and plastered house with a crosswing at the south end and a return front at No 41 Nethergate Street. Much altered and refronted in the early C19, with a parapet on the east front. Now faced in roughcast. 2 storeys and attics. 4 window range on the east front and 2 window range on the south front, double-hung sashes with glazing bars, in flush cased frames, One of the 1st storey windows on the east front has the carved sill of a former oriel window, carved with figures and a shield. No 41 Nethergate Street has 2 early C19 shop fronts, one on the south front has fluted pilasters with a cornice and is flanked by 2 doorways, one with a 6-panel door, reeded pilasters and a cornice hood on paired brackets. The other shop front is a good example of its kind, with a corner 6-panel double door with a rectangular fanlight, flanking small paned shop windows with glazing bars (thin section), narrow pilasters and a continuous fascia cornice. Roofs tiled, with 1 segmental headed dormer on the east front.
Nos 1 to 8 (consec) with Nos 28, 29 and 31, all the listed buildings in Well Lane, Stone Hall and Nos 36 to 40 (consec) Nethergate Street form a group.
